Application of natural immune activator ergothioneine in antiviral

The application discloses an application of ergothioneine in antiviral in the field of biotechnology. The ergothioneine plays an immune activation role at least by activating TLR4 and downstream NF-kappa B signal pathways. The ergothioneine is used for preparing an immunomodulator or an antiviral drug, can effectively activate immune cells and enhance antiviral capacity, to a certain extent, overcomes defects of traditional technologies, reduces problems of large side effects of current TLR4 agonists, and provides a new idea for developing a novel immunomodulator and an antiviral treatment strategy.

Hyperthermia-induced gut microbiome-mediated modulation of host immune system for treatment of gastric / gastric malt / duodenal cancer

The present invention provides a hyperthermia-induced gut microbiome- mediated modulation of the host immune system for the treatment of gastric / gastric MALT / Duodenum cancer; the said system uses a wild type / non-pathogenic / attenuated strain coated with iron oxide nanoparticles to specifically target the cancerous tissue by applying an external field around the gastric tissue the said iron oxide generates heat on bacteria surface and causes lysis of bacteria in the tumor microenvironment; the lysis of bacteria triggers various potent immune activator and cytokines to activate antigen-presenting cells including lymphocytes and macrophages; the said antigen presenting cell further, eliminates cancer cell from the gut microenvironment and eventually clean tumor microenvironment. Additionally, the activated lymphocytes will be antigenic memory against bacterial particles and cancer tissues. Furthermore, the said treatment system does not involve the use of any chemotherapeutic drug or radiation treatment and, thus, precludes undesirable side effects of chemotherapy as well as minimizes toxicity.

ROS (reactive oxygen species) double-response nanoparticles for co-delivery of metabolic inhibitors and immune activators as well as preparation method and application of ROS double-response nanoparticles

The invention belongs to the technical field of medicines, and particularly relates to ROS (reactive oxygen species) double-response nanoparticles for co-delivery of metabolic inhibitors and immune activators as well as a preparation method and application of the ROS double-response nanoparticles. The nanoparticles comprise a phenylboronic acid ester modified polymer which responds to ROS cracking, a ferrocene modified polymer which responds to ROS catalytic Fenton reaction, S-Gboxin which inhibits mitochondrial ATP synthesis, and a TGF-beta inhibitor Galunissertib which regulates immunity. The nanoparticles are targeted to Glut1 through DHA to mediate tumor targeting, and after entering tumor tissues and incorporating cells, the nanoparticles respond to ROS phenylboronic acid ester splitting decomposition, and drug release is accelerated; and under the catalysis of ferrocene, the common ROS in the tumor cells is converted into the superoxide compound with higher oxidation capacity. The released S-Gboxin is combined with the inner membrane of mitochondria, so that the membrane potential is reduced, and the tumor energy supply is inhibited. Similarly, the Galunissertib down regulates the tumor microenvironment TGF-beta, inhibits the expression of proteins pSMAD2 / 3 and TSP-1, and remodels the immunosuppressive microenvironment.

Exosome-coated spherical ICG light immune activator as well as preparation method and application of exosome-coated spherical ICG light immune activator

The invention discloses an exosome-coated spherical ICG photoimmune activator CND-ICG at Exo as well as a preparation method and application thereof, and belongs to the technical field of nano biological medicines. The photoimmune activator is prepared by forming a CND-ICG compound from a carbon dot material CND and indocyanine green ICG through an esterification reaction and then wrapping tumor cell exosomes TDEs through an ultrasonic method. Through covalent coupling of CND and ICG, the defects that free ICG is poor in light stability, low in water solubility and rapid in-vivo elimination are overcome; by combining the tumor targeting and immune activation capability of TDEs, the photoimmune activator is efficiently enriched at the tumor site of triple negative breast cancer TNBC, the synergistic effect of photothermal tumor killing and immune activation can be achieved under laser irradiation, and meanwhile, the near-infrared imaging function is achieved. The activator is high in tumor cell killing rate and good in biological safety, and a new technical scheme is provided for precise diagnosis and treatment integration of TNBC.

Immunoactivator, vaccine adjuvant, and method for inducing immunity

Dislcosed is an immunoactivator that is capable of enhancing induction of both humoral immunity and cellular immunity and contains an active ingredient derived from cell walls (derived from a natural product); a vaccine adjuvant; and a method for inducing immunity including administering the immunoactivator. Theimmunoactivator contains, as an active ingredient, particles having a maximum diameter within a range of 1 to 800 nm, wherein the particles comprise cell-wall-derived polysaccharides.
